[QUOTE="ss7mm, post: 270503, member: 5"] I've been reading this and find it very interesting. There are many ways to indicate a person's involvement with LRH. Most of them are already in place but not always readily apparent to the newcomer to our site. It's been mentioned that "join date" and "post count" are already on each post and easily read but........remember that some newcomers don't "see" things sometimes. That is evident by the same questions being asked over and over by new members. I've watched on other sites when they incorporated different types of "rating systems" for the members and I guarantee you, it can get ugly. If there is a way for members to advance someone, there is a way to set them back and therein lies the rub. Get into a "discussion" with someone and make him mad and badda bing, badda boom, you just got "demoted". If you're looking for something that would indicate a person's involvement with LRH, and that is typically tied to post count, but not always, how about something that would indicate their dedication, involvement and contribution to LRH. Something like "contributor" and "benefactor", or something similar. This would be tied to post count like the current titles but would indicate time, support and commitment to the LRH site and it's members. [/QUOTE]
